ODHS Vocational Rehabilitation (VR) provides support to individuals with disabilities to help them find and retain jobs suited to their skills, interests, and capabilities. The services offered by VR encompass vocational counseling, assessments, physical rehabilitation, skills development, job placement assistance, and support for independent living. These services are delivered in partnership with businesses, state agencies, community rehabilitation organizations, and providers of independent living services.
Intake Process: Contact to schedule an appointment.
Costs: No fees involved.
Who can use this
- Applicants must have a verified physical, mental, or emotional condition that hinders their ability to secure or maintain employment.
